1. Ifa says that it foresees peace and comfort for a newly wedded woman or for
a lady about to get married. Her matrimonial home will bring her success and
elevation. Ifa says that all her progress and achievements had gone to wait
for her in her matrimonial home. It is therefore a wise decision for her to get
married at that period. Ebo materials: two hens, two guinea fowls, two
pigeons, two roosters and money. She also needs to feed her Ori with one
guinea fowl. On this, Ifa says:
Ose ro
Ose o ro
Dia fun Ororo Iyawo
Ti nrele oko re nigbayi
Ebo ni won ni ko waa se
O gbebo, o rubo
Iyawo ororo ti nrele oko o re nigbayi o
Aje nba e e lo o
Iya Ororo
Omo tuntun n ba e e lo o
Iyawo Ororo
Ire gbogbo n ba e e lo o
Iyawo Ororo
Translation
Ose ro
And Ose o ro
They cast Ifa for a newly wedded woman
When going to her husbands home
She was advised to offer ebo
She complied
The newly wedded woman going to her husbands home this time around
Wealth is accompanying you there
The newly wedded woman
Children are following you there
The newly wedded woman
All ire of life are following you there
The newly wedded woman
2. Ifa advises this person to offer ebo against uprising. It is about to enter the
household. The crisis will be instigated by the Elders of the Night. Ebo
materials: one mature he goat, four okete, and money. The four okete will be
used to feed the Elder of the Night and the he goat will be slaughtered and all
the internal organs will be used to feed the Elders again.
Ose ro
Ose o ro
Dia fun won nile e Liki
Nijo ajogun Eleye ka won mole pitipiti
Ebo ni won ni ki won waa se
Won gbebo, won rubo
Ko pe, ko jinna
E wa ba ni laruuse ogun o
Ajase ogun laa ba ni lese Obarisa
Translation
Ose ro
Ose o ro
Ifas message for the inhabitants of Liki land
When the crises of the witches overwhelmed them totally
They were advised to offer ebo
They complied
Before long, not too far
Join use where we use ebo to overcome crisis
Ability to overcome is what Ifa assures its devotees

5. Ifa advises a leader here to eschew greed or avarice. He/she must not cheat
his/her subordinates and must take good care of them. He/she must trust
them and must not be too inquisitive about their activities. He/she must also
delegate responsibilities and authority. If he/she fails to do these, he/she will
invite disgrace to himself/herself. Ebo materials: one mature ram and money.
He/she also needs to feed his/her Ori with a female sheep.
Ka wo igba eni
Ka maa ran nise
O daa ju ki agbalagba o fira re se iko lo o
Dia fun Amuwonmi
Tii se olori eye loko
Ebo ni won ni ko waa se
O gbebo, o rubo
A ti mu Okin je olori eye
Ariwo eye n la
Okiki eye n ta kuu
Okin de o, Olori Eye o
Translation
Let us look for 200 people to send on errands
It is better than for an elder to turn himself into a delegate
Ifas message for Amuwonmi
The head of the Birds in the forest
He was advised to offer ebo
He complied
We have installed the Peacock as the head of the Birds in the forest
The noise of the Birds is deafening
And the reputation of the Birds is overwhelming
6. Ifa advises a woman seeking the blessing of the fruit of the womb to offer ebo
for her to receive this blessing. Ebo materials: three hens, three pigeons and
money. She also needs to feed Osun with one hen, plenty of akara and maize
beer.
Ose lolosun
Irosun lo lOse
Dia fun Yeyee mi Otooro Efon
Omo Ejigbojo ile ode Ido
O feyinti moju ekun sunrahu tomo
Ebo ni won ni ko waa se
O gbebo, o rubo
E ki Yeyee mi o, Afide remo
Yeyee mi o, Afide remo
Translation
Ose lolosun
Irosun lo lOse
They cast Ifa for My Mother, the Otooro of Efon land
Offspringof the rainfall that took over the whole of Ido land
When weeping in lamentation of her inability to have a baby
She was advised to offer ebo
She complied
All hail my mother, who placates a child with brass ornaments
Yeye e mi o, who placates a child with brass ornaments
7. Ifa advises this person not to go into any joint venture with anyone in order
for him/her not to be swindled by his/her business partner(s). ebo materials:
three pigeons, three guinea fowls, three roosters and money. He/she also
needs to feed Ifa with two rats and two fish.
See Efun
See Osun
See Osun
See Efon
Dia fun Erin
Ti yoo maa sowo ike ni gbigbe
Ti Atioro yoo maa gba a ta
Ebo ni won ni ko waa se
O koti ogbonyin sebo
Gbogbo isowo ope
Eni gbebo nibe ko waa sebo o
Translation
See Efun
See Osun
See Osun
See Efon
Ifas message for Erin, the Elephant
When going to start the business of ivory carving
And Atioro will be collecting them for sale
He was advised to offer ebo
He failed to comply
All Ifa devotees
Let those advised to offer ebo do so accordingly

9. Ifa says that this person is either too much of a weakling or too much a high
handed person. Ifa advocate moderation in all the things that he/she is
doing. If he/she is too weak, others will cheat him/her. If he/she is too high
handed, others will run away from him/her. Ebo materials; four guinea-fowls,
four pigeons, four roosters, and money. He/she also needs to feed Sango
with 10 land snails first, and after he/she needs to feed Sango again with one
mature ram. Ifa says that this person has a tendency of going into extremes.
That is why Ifa recommends moderation for him/her.
Translation
The squirrel does not chirp in the room of Alagotun
Ifas message for Alagotun
The offspring of the heavy down pour
The flows over the rock
Alagotun
The offspring of the heavy down pour
The flows over the rock
He cast Ifa for Olalanfe
The offspring of the leopard that wears spotted garment
He was advised to offer ebo
Olalanfe display meekness with moderation
You are installed into a chieftaincy title
And the world witnessed peace and tranquility
Meekness requires moderation
Olalanfe
The offspring of the leopard that wears spotted garment
Display high handed with moderation
You are installed into a chieftaincy title
And you destroy the world
High handed requires moderation
Olalanfe
The offspring of the leopard that wears spotted garment
That is the name of Sango

16.Ifa warns this person to go and apologies to his father because he had done
something very wrong against his father. Without confessing and apologizing
it will be very difficult for him to progress in life. He may think that his father
does not know is misdeed, he is wrong. His father knows most of what he
had done wrong if not all, but the father chose to remain quiet because of
other consideration that he is not aware of. Ebo materials; one mature he-
goat, and money.
Translation
Refusal to take the eye off a ripe palm-kernel is what lead to death of
Atioro bird
Ifas message for Omololus father
And also for Omololu himself
When he was secretly making love to his fathers wife
He was advised to offer ebo
He declared that he was the person who was doing things that other
people were not aware of
The father responded that there is no one doing things that others
were not aware of
There are only those who had of others misconduct but had chosen not
to ask
In order for there not to be a minus in the work force on the farm
Aboru Aboye.
